It is a novel, who had been published in 1811, it was the first of Austen's novels to be published, under the pseudonym "A Lady". The novel is about people who had money and property, about their senses, emotions and relations. The book is interesting, with several drawings.
The story revolves around Marieanne and Elinor, two Mr. Dashwood`s daughters. And they have a younger sister, Margaret, and an older half-brother John. When their father suddenly dies, Mr. Dashwood and her daughters must leave their family home, the beautiful Norland Park. They must move to a small cottage in Devon.
The novel follows the Dashwood sisters to their news home, where they experience both romance and heartbreak. Book`s title describes how Elinor and Marianne find a balance between sense and sensibility in life and love.…
